Output 7b23c8e7272e689721821a966b1861570924718f71c0057a607c7e0a027906b4:75

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 360026591342fd2931948df1baec3934c76b664d80b59409eae2a9815b6c4f7b
address
bc1pxcqzvkgngt7jjvv53hcm4mpexnrkkejdsz6egz02u25czkmvfaaswhqjy6
transaction
7b23c8e7272e689721821a966b1861570924718f71c0057a607c7e0a027906b4
spent
true